Transaction 3d86ebd84e140e093971b3d9347a076bd844f9391cbfa11d14945b3a5a9dc495

17 Input
2 Outputs
  • 3d86ebd84e140e093971b3d9347a076bd844f9391cbfa11d14945b3a5a9dc495:0
  • value  268200000
    address  1Q9Gb6K6BWMYsxjcvEGtB5WZcXPgUXioRg
  • 3d86ebd84e140e093971b3d9347a076bd844f9391cbfa11d14945b3a5a9dc495:1
  • value  454597
    address  1EFaPjQRxcuFD3comzF8ocEs21GUxzutXy